What a GEM!! Nate (Tyler Ross) is a 19 year old film student living in Chicago who is best friends with Margaret, a 52 year old spinster (played by Natalie West) who aspires to become a stand-up comedian.
It surprised me to see how well they connected as friends considering the huge generational gap. Regardless, Nate gets invited to a party where he meets James and both fall in love. Nate's new romance with James will disrupt and perhaps hurt his friendship with Margaret but as Jeannette Catsoulis of the NY Times said in her review: "blessed with natural performances and brisk pacing, this unusual little movie would like us to know just one thing: Passion is fine, but a pal is PRICELESS".
When time goes by, Nate will finally discover who is a REAL friend. Life is about to teach him a lesson in friendship. Recommended and even better- it is available on Netflix instant streaming!
